WhiteWater announced that WhiteWater, MPLX (MPLX), ONEOK (OKE) and Enbridge (ENB), through their Matterhorn joint venture, have partnered with affiliates of ONEOK and MPLX and reached final investment decision to move forward with the construction of the Eiger Express Pipeline, having secured sufficient firm transportation agreements with primarily investment grade shippers. The Eiger Express Pipeline is designed to transport up to 2.5 billion cubic feet per day of natural gas through approximately 450 miles of 42-inch pipeline from the Permian Basin in West Texas to the Katy area. The Eiger Express Pipeline is a joint venture owned 70% by the Matterhorn JV, 15% by ONEOK, and 15% by MPLX. ONEOK’s and MPLX’s direct ownership interests in the Eiger Express Pipeline joint venture are incremental to their ownership through the Matterhorn JV, resulting in 25.5% and 22% ownership in the pipeline, respectively. The Eiger Express Pipeline will be constructed and operated by WhiteWater and is expected to be in service in mid-2028, pending the receipt of customary regulatory and other approvals.
